Folding Treadmills For Home If you want to improve your fitness but don't have plenty of space for a treadmill, consider a folding model. These treadmills fold and come with wheels for transport to make storage easier. Non-folding treadmills are large in footprint, which makes them unsuitable for smaller spaces. They have some advantages, which may make them worth the cost. They take up less space Folding treadmills are an excellent alternative to non-folding models that can be bulky or difficult to store. They allow you to work out without taking up all of the room. This is especially beneficial for those with little space in their homes. But while the treadmill that folds can be more compact and fit into your space, it's crucial to evaluate the durability of this model against its other features and capabilities. Read reviews and ratings from customers before purchasing to ensure that the product is durable and of high-quality. Think about the maximum speed your treadmill could reach. Some folding treadmills can only achieve speeds of three miles per hour (mph) which is adequate for casual walkers, but not enough for those who wish to run. Dr. Penwell recommends that you choose a treadmill that has an increased maximum speed if you're planning to purchase an adjustable treadmill. Another factor to consider is the display and console options. Some folding treadmills come with a simple screen that shows your distance along with time and pulse. Some have more complicated programs that can enhance your experience when you exercise. For example some treadmills that fold allow you to follow trainer-led workouts or play games while running and can keep you occupied and help in the long run to keep you motivated. Some of these machines have an locking mechanism on the hinge mechanism that you must remove before folding. If you have small children at home, make sure that you place the lock away from reach. Otherwise, you could risk an injury. Additionally, some folding treadmills don't come with gas shocks that gently lowers the deck to the ground when released. This could pose a risk for children, pets, and people with balance issues. The maximum speed of a folding treadmill is another thing to take into consideration. Some models have top speeds that are suitable for walking and not running, whereas other models are capable of 12 miles per hour and higher. It's a good idea to verify the maximum weight capacity of your folding treadmill prior to buying it to be certain that it will support your weight and any additional gear that you may want to wear during your workouts such as ankle weights or a vest with weights. Fitness experts suggest that when you're searching for a treadmill you should look at two aspects: the horsepower of the motor and the size. For instance, if are planning to primarily run on a power treadmill or just occasionally take a quick jog, look for an option with 2.0-2.5 chp. If you intend to run regularly however, it's best to find an exercise machine with 2.5 chp or more to ensure you can run at an acceptable speed without putting yourself at risk of injury. It is also worth considering the possibility of a treadmill with adjustable incline settings. Most folding treadmills have an incline of up to 10 percent, but if you are a serious runner, you may prefer a treadmill with a higher slope.
